As the title says, is there a way to make multiple user boxes at once or do they have to be created one by one? I'm trying to create a secure way for all users to print so they don't leave their papers at the printer. I tried using User Authentication with Active Directory, but inputting a username and a password every time is quite the hassle for all users. Thanks in advance

Use "ID and Print" with User List and password. Or get a card reader setup with "ID and Print"

That means if the user authenticates on the machine there work will print.

The problem with ID and Print is that it also blocks scanning and copying, things that the users do on a regular basis. I just need some sort of PIN to unlock a printing job when the user is ready to actually go to the printer which is why User Boxes are the best choice so far, but managing them is tedious. Turn on secure print in the driver code each user a different pin.
They walk up to machine select user box secure print type there pin and they release only their jobs.
